A Journey Back in Time

A true testimony to the tea plantation heritage

A true testament to the rich heritage of tea plantations, Stafford Estate began as a coffee plantation before transitioning to tea cultivation. The main planter’s bungalow, constructed in 1884, served as the residence for pioneering Scottish tea planters Sir G.H.D. Elphinstone and J. Paterson Sr. This historic bungalow offered them breathtaking views of the estate and its surroundings.

In late 2013, a significant restoration and renovation breathed new life into this charming heritage bungalow, transforming it into one of the most elegant plantation retreats in the country. The renovation beautifully balances the colonial charm and heritage with contemporary design, making Stafford Bungalow a tribute to its founders and a celebration of the tea plantation legacy.

The Heritage Bungalow is the original plantation house — four rooms set within the 1884 building, with fireplaces, period joinery, and the full character of a working highland estate. The Owner’s Cottage is a more contemporary private retreat within the same estate grounds: two suites, and a terrace that frames the valley.

Stafford Bungalow sits within a privately owned tea estate established in 1884 in the highlands of Ragala, Nuwara Eliya, Sri Lanka. It is a luxury boutique villa. The estate spans 50 acres of working tea fields — still harvested, still producing — set at over 5,000 feet above sea level. Those who come stay in either the Heritage Bungalow or the Owner’s Cottage: six rooms and suites in total, shared across two residences. The scale is deliberate. At any given time, the estate belongs almost entirely to the people staying here.

Stafford Bungalow offers a private pool a heated jacuzzi, the Garden Pavilion for meals and gatherings, estate grounds of 50 acres open to those staying here, and the working tea plantation as both backdrop and experience. Fireplaces are lit in the Heritage Bungalow and Pavillion through the cooler months. What particularly exists is the estate is the peace that comes from a place this age, the clear air at this altitude, and much living history around it.

Stafford Bungalow is situated in Ragala, within the Nuwara Eliya district of Sri Lanka’s central highlands. Ragala lies at around 5000 feet (1,500 meters) above sea level, in a valley, below Nuwara Eliya town. The estate sits within working tea country — surrounded on most sides by plantation and eucalyptus forest and vegetation, with views across the valley that extend, on clear days, to the far ranges of the highland interior.
